Expert Summary

Dr. Camacho, is an expert in advanced laparoscopic general surgery and bariatric surgery. Of special note, he is a pioneer in single incision laparoscopic surgery for multiple procedures including cholecystectomy, foregut surgery, partial gastrectomies and hernia repairs. More recently, Dr. Camacho has been developing and creating new applications for the emerging field of Natural Orifice Translumenal Surgery (NOTES) including esophageal reflux surgery. He is one of only a small number of surgeons performing this surgery in the U.S. Dr. Camacho holds a medical degree from the Universidad Francisco Marroquin in Guatemala City, Guatemala. He completed his residency in general surgery at Ohio State University Medical Center and completed fellowship training in minimally invasive surgery at Baylor College of Medicine's Michael E. Debakey Department of Surgery.
